#03339f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#03339f is composed of 1.2% red, 20%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.1% cyan, 67.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 221.5 degrees, a saturation of 96.3% and a lightness of 31.8%. #03339f color hex could be obtained by blending #0666ff with #00003f.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

Shades and Tints of #03339f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000205 is the darkest color, while #f1f5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#03339f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e5054 is the less saturated color, while #03339f is the most saturated one.
